History of Fulton County, Illinois; together with
Sketches of its Cities, Villages and Townships, Educational, Religious,
Civil, Military, and Political History; Portraits of Prominent Persons
and Biographies of Representative Citizens. Chas. C. Chapman & Co.,
Peoria, Illinois, 1879, page 472, Banner Township
William Gibson was born in Beaver Co., Pa., Aug. 7, 1833. He
resides at present upon section 8, Banner township, where he is engaged
in farming. The parents of our subject are William and Hopey (Miller)
Gibson, natives of the Keystone State. Mr. G. came to Fulton county in
1855 and ten years later was married to Agnes Beck. They had a family
of 6 children - 4 boys and 2 girls, all of whom are living. He belongs
to the M. E. Church and is a republican in politics.
